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SAPAPO/PPM_MAINTAIN -
Message number: 210
Message text: Material &1 not SNP relevant (alternative component --> &2 &3 &4)

- Material &1 not SNP relevant (alternative component --> &2 &3 &4) ?The SAP error message
/SAPAPO/PPM_MAINTAIN210
indicates that a specific material is not relevant for SNP (Supply Network Planning) in the context of alternative components. This error typically arises in the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) module when trying to maintain or process a product that has alternative components defined, but one or more of those components are not set up correctly for SNP.Cause:
- Material Not Marked as SNP Relevant: The material in question (denoted as &1 in the error message) is not marked as SNP relevant in the system. This means that it cannot be included in SNP planning processes.
- Alternative Components Issues: The alternative components (denoted as &2, &3, &4) may also not be marked as SNP relevant, or they may not be properly configured in the system.
- Master Data Configuration: There may be issues with the master data configuration for the materials involved, such as missing or incorrect settings in the material master or the SNP planning book.
- Planning Area Settings: The planning area may not be set up to include the materials or their alternatives.
Solution:
Check Material Master Data:
- Go to the material master record for the material &1 and ensure that it is marked as SNP relevant. This can be done in transaction
MM02
(Change Material) under the "MRP" view.- Verify that the alternative components (&2, &3, &4) are also marked as SNP relevant.
Review Alternative Components:
- Ensure that the alternative components are correctly defined in the system. Check if they are assigned to the same planning area as the main material.
- Make sure that the alternative components are also set up in the product master data in APO.
Check Planning Area Configuration:
- Review the configuration of the planning area to ensure that it includes the materials and their alternatives. This can be done in the SAP APO system under the planning area settings.
Re-assign or Update SNP Settings:
- If the materials are not SNP relevant, you may need to update their settings to make them relevant. This can involve reassigning them to the correct planning area or updating their SNP settings.
Consult Documentation:
-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for more detailed guidance on configuring materials for SNP relevance.
Testing:
- After making the necessary changes, test the process again to ensure that the error does not reoccur.
